[SOLVED] How to find forum user registration number?

Out of curiosity I tried to find my registration number here on the Arch forum. The ID from the URL tells me that I'm forum user number 70676, but the forum member counter tells me that there's only 44154 registered users. Does this mean that over 25000 users has left the forum from variouse reasons, or doesn't the user ID number tell us anything? 25000 sounds like a lot.

A long while ago, we did a major clean up by removing inactive accounts, i.e. no posts and no login since a year (or never login) IIRC. That probably explain the large number of "missing" accounts.
